Director RDD inaugurates “Vehj Moaj Public Park” at Vehil Shopian
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

SHOPIAN: The Director, Rural Development (RDD) Kashmir, Imam-ud-Din today visited Vehil Shopian and inaugurated “Vehj Moaj Public Park” at Vehil Shopian, executed by Rural Development Department and coming up at an estimated cost of Rs 8 lacs.

He also visited various works completed by RDD including One Stop Centre and Public Library and expressed satisfaction with the quality of the works.

Later, the Director reviewed the progress of various schemes and other developmental works at Mini Secretariat Shopian.

He directed the concerned field functionaries to speed up the process of execution and ensure the completion of all ongoing works within the stipulated time frame.

Director reviewed the performance of the Rural Development Department with regard to the implementation and progress of various schemes in the district.

Detailed deliberations were held on various schemes being implemented by the Rural development department like MGNREGA, Pradhan Mantri Awaas Yojana, SBM-G and 14th FC, TSP, and BADP.

Assistant Commissioner Development presented a detailed PowerPoint presentation about the achievements and progress made under the centrally sponsored schemes in the district. He said that the district has 25000 active Job cards.

ACD also briefed the chair about the number of works taken up and completed during the year 2019-20 and 2021-22 under MGNREGA and PMAY.

Addressing the officers during the meeting, the Director stressed upon them to work in coordination for better implementation of the schemes on the ground and ensure that Government work should not suffer and directed for removing bottlenecks, if any, in the execution of development works for timely completion.

BDOs were directed to achieve targets within the stipulated time and to work with transparency and accountability.

Vigilance Awareness was also conducted and it was stressed to all to ensure transparency and a corruption-free environment in the offices.

SE, Saif Ali Kataria, Assistant Commissioner Development, Hilal Ahmed Jeri, Ex. Engineer REW, Manzoor Ahmed Wani, BDOs, AEs, JEEs, and other concerned officers were present.
